  • Unit Trusts are investment products and some may involve derivatives. The value of investments, unit prices and income distribution may go down or up, and the investor may not get back the original sum invested. Past performance of a fund should not be taken as indicative of its future performance. In a worst case scenario, the value of fund may worth substantially less than the original amount you have invested (and in an extreme case could be worth nothing).
  • The investment returns, repayment of capital and distribution payouts are not guaranteed. Investors and potential investors must not solely rely on the content in this website to make investment decisions. Investors are advised to read carefully and understand the contents of prospectus and consider the general risk factors associated with investing in unit trusts in addition to other specific risks uniquely associated with the fund. All the relevant risk factors are set out in the relevant prospectus for the fund.
  • You are advised to carefully consider your own circumstances, including not only the product risk level of your selected investment, but also your financial situation, investment knowledge and/or experience, investment objective and preferred investment period. Switching of fixed deposits into any Unit Trusts beyond your risk appetite is highly discouraged.
  • When you subscribe into any Unit Trusts with us, the investment amount will be deducted directly from your settlement account(s) with us. Investors and potential investors are reminded not to provide cash for investment purposes to any HSBC employees. Pre-signed forms are also strictly prohibited.
  • Before you make any investment decision, you may wish to engage or speak to your relationship manager to understand more about any investment product including the applicable charges, investment objective and return expectation. For first time investors, you should also be made aware of your cooling-off rights for eligible funds.
  • Unit Trusts are NOT protected by Perbadanan Insurans Deposit Malaysia ("PIDM").

What are unit trusts?

Unit trusts pool the resources of investors into one large fund, which is then divided into shares, or 'units'. Unit trusts are managed by professional fund managers and have varying levels of risk and return.

Whether you are making your first investment, or adding an investment to your portfolio, at HSBC you can choose from a range of funds to match your attitude to risk and investment goals.

Why invest in Unit Trusts?

  • Diversifying risk
    Your investment is spread across a diverse portfolio.
  • Professional management
    Fund managers whose expertise is working for you.
  • Access to worldwide markets
    Your money can be invested in financial markets globally.
  • Invest at your own pace
    Begin with a lump sum investment or progressively build your portfolio with monthly contribution.

Why is diversification important

  • Minimises the risk of loss
    To your overall investment portfolio by reducing potential volatility.
  • More opportunities for return
    Spreads your investments to different asset classes.
  • Protects against adverse market cycles
    Protection from unexpected market crisis like the COVID-19 pandemic.

Things you should know

Only individuals registered with Federation of Investment Managers Malaysia (FiMM) as consultants are authorised to promote, market and distribute unit trust schemes. To better safeguard your interest during any discussion and investment related to unit trust schemes, you are advised to access https://www.fimm.com.my/search and key in the full name of the unit trust consultant to verify if they are authorised by FiMM.

Front End Load (“FEL”) is the upfront cost that an investor incurs upon subscription/purchase of UT Funds (Equity/Mixed Assets/Bond).
